My Buying Guides on Small Camper A/C Unit
When I decided to get a small camper A/C unit, I quickly realized there are a few key things to consider to make the right choice. Here’s what I learned from my experience that might help you pick the perfect unit for your camper.
1. Understand Your Camper Size and Cooling Needs
The first thing I did was measure my camper’s interior space. Small campers usually need A/C units with lower BTU (British Thermal Units) ratings—typically between 5,000 and 8,000 BTUs. If you pick a unit that’s too powerful, it can cycle on and off too frequently, wasting energy. Too weak, and it won’t cool effectively. Knowing your camper’s size helped me narrow down options.
2. Power Source Compatibility
I had to think about how I’d power the A/C. Most small camper units run on 12V DC, 110V AC, or a combination of both. Since I camp off-grid sometimes, I looked for units that could run on my camper’s battery and solar setup without draining everything too fast. If you mostly stay at campgrounds, a 110V unit plugged into shore power might be fine.
3. Portability and Installation
Because my camper is small, I wanted an A/C unit that was easy to install or even portable enough to move around. Some units mount on the roof, while others are portable and can be set near a window or vent. I found roof-mounted units require more installation effort but save space inside. Portable units gave me flexibility but sometimes were less powerful.
4. Energy Efficiency and Power Consumption
Energy efficiency was a big priority for me since I rely on batteries and solar panels. I looked for units with good energy ratings and features like eco mode or adjustable fan speeds. These help reduce power use when full cooling isn’t necessary, extending my battery life during trips.
5. Noise Levels
A noisy A/C can ruin a peaceful camping experience. I checked user reviews to find units known for quieter operation. Some small camper A/C units have noise ratings listed in decibels (dB). I aimed for something under 60 dB to keep things comfortable without loud humming.
6. Additional Features to Consider
I also looked for extras like built-in thermostats, remote controls, dehumidifiers, and air filters. These features made using the unit more convenient and improved air quality inside my camper.
7. Budget and Warranty
Finally, I set a budget but kept in mind that cheaper units might not last or perform well. Investing a bit more in a reputable brand with a solid warranty gave me peace of mind. Check what the warranty covers and how easy it is to get support if needed.
